The property is move-in ready and shows evidence of significant past renovations that have been well-maintained. While originally built in 1964, the kitchen and bathrooms feature updated components such as stainless steel appliances, stone countertops, and a modern glass-enclosed shower. The interior boasts high-quality finishes including slate tile and hardwood flooring, recessed lighting, and custom built-ins. Although the Mediterranean styling and some fixtures reflect a renovation period from approximately 10-15 years ago rather than a brand-new build, the home is in excellent functional condition with no visible deferred maintenance.
